The Robert Minden DUO is the creative partnership of Carla Hallett and Robert Minden. Working together, since 1986, in recording and performance projects, they formed the Duo in 1996 to explore an allusive world of storytelling and song. A relentless pursuit of the sonic possibilities of urban junk and children's toys inspires their creations. Recordings and live performance mix Minden's storytelling and Hallett's experimental vocals with uncommon acoustic instruments (musical saws, waterphones, toy piano, theremin, children's toys and found sounds) creating a dramatic mix.
Sometimes described as "the house band at the restaurant at the end of the universe."(Gary Norris, Canadian Press), their latest CD, are you now, "...superb sonic treat...", suggests a curious acoustic soundscape like a folk music from an invented world. The Minden Duo's live concerts, continue to surprise and tour to select venues and festivals.The work is sometimes melodic, sometimes microtonal, percussive, experimental, brimming with enthusiasm for acoustic sounds. While there are classical references the music moves towards the exploration of acoustic sound sources using invented instruments and found sound, the listener invited to explore sounds as sounds and the ideas that sounds embody.
Recognizing the vital role of the arts in education the Minden DUO continues to produce work for young audience. Lost Sound, Found Sound, a live school performance and hands on workshops, is recognized internationally by educators for inspiring children to focus their creative abilities. Robert Minden Duo Launch Ontario Tour
Robert Minden & Carla Hallett, in their twenty-first year of touring, will bring their original performance to communities
in southern Ontario May 2008.The 21-performance tour begins May 12. bringing the Minden DUOs unusual approach to music into schools in
Ottawa, Gloucester, Lombardy, Merrickville, Madoc and Toronto. While in Ottawa, The DUO will perform
at the Canadian Museum of Civilization and will end their tour with a concert for Torontos SoundaXis new music Festival
at the Music Gallery, June 1. The tour is supported by the Canada Council for the Arts.
